UPDATED TRAVEL PROTOCOL FOR DUBAI
DUBAI UPDATED TRAVEL PROTOCOL
The
following conditions must be met for all flights to/from DXB or DWC which will
be effective from 31 January 2021:
1. UAE residents, GCC citizens & tourists arriving to DXB/DWC
All UAE residents, GCC citizens, and visitors traveling to
Dubai will need to do a pre-travel (before departure) PCR test, irrespective of the country they are coming from.
2. Validity period of PCR tests had been reduced from 96 hours to 72 hours.
3. If travelling from Bangladesh to Dubai, a second test will also occur upon arrival in Dubai.
4. Transit passengers from Bangladesh arriving at DXB/DWC.
Transit passenger is not
allowed to Dubai right now due to Covid-19 pandemic.If DUBAI airport authority allow then all transiting passengers arriving from Bangladesh are required to present a
negative COVID 19 PCR test certificate, as well as to follow
any requirements for their final destination.
5. UAE Nationals from all countries arriving to DXB/DWC.
All UAE Nationals are Not required to
conduct PCR test before arriving at DXB/DWC , PCR Test on arrival only.
6. Departing from DXB to all countries.
All passengers are required to follow final destination
requirements.
7. Download the COVID 19 DXB Smart App before arriving at DXB/DWC.
